INSTALLATION
The following checks shall be made to installations using A2L
refrigerants:
1. The actual charge is in accordance with the room size within
which the refrigerant containing parts are installed.
2. Supplementary ventilation machinery and outlets are operat-
ing adequately and are not obstructed.
3. For appliances utilizing indirect refrigeration, the secondary
circuit shall be checked for the presence of refrigerant.
4. Warning markings on the equipment is visible and legible,
with those that are not being either replaced or corrected.
5. Refrigerant piping or components are installed in a position
where they are unlikely to be exposed to any substance which
may corrode them, unless the components are constructed of
materials which are inherently resistant to being corroded or
are suitably protected against said corrosion.
6. Validate that the A2L leak dissipation function is operational
by using the test function on the A2L dissipation board.
Base Rail Split
A base rail split between the primary coil/fan section and the ac-
cessory sections is optional. If this option has been selected, the
39L unit will arrive at the job site assembled as one piece. The
split allows the unit to be separated at the joint.
If the unit must be separated in the field, follow this procedure:
1. Remove the lifting lugs on the inlet side of the coil/fan sec-
tion and those on the outlet side of the accessory section to
liberate the T-bracket. See Fig
14.
2. Unscrew the flanges (top and sides) around the coil/fan
section and the accessory section. See Fig.
15.
NOTE: If the section-to-section gasket installed at the factory
is damaged while splitting the unit, obtain the required length
of 1/8 in. x 1-1/4 in. foam gasketing locally.
After rejoining the split sections, fully tighten all AB 1/4-3/4 in.
screws on the flanges and the AB 1/4-5/8 in. screws on the
flanges. See Fig.
16.

CAUTION
Ensure that a good seal is created between both sections before
continuing. A poor seal may result in equipment damage.
